A 2026 planning range
As of August 2026, published U.S. cost guides put deck-railing repairs at $25 to $100 per linear foot and replacement at $50 to $250 per linear foot. A standard whole-job replacement commonly falls around $900 to $1,800. The extent of damage, railing material, and condition of the deck framing usually change the price most.
These are planning figures, not a diagnosis or quote. “Unsafe railing” is not one repair category. It may describe loose fasteners, a failed post connection, deteriorated material, missing components, or a guard that does not meet the requirements applied by the local authority.
| Planning scenario | Published cost reference | What can move it |
|---|---|---|
| Localized repair | $25–$100 per linear foot | Number of loose or damaged sections, access, matching the existing finish |
| Standard replacement | $900–$1,800 total | Overall length, ordinary materials, labor rates, removal |
| Extensive or custom replacement | $50–$250 per linear foot | Premium material, stairs, corners, difficult access, damaged supports |
The rows are not fixed bids, and they can overlap. A short custom section can cost more per foot than a long, straightforward wood railing. Conversely, replacing hardware on an otherwise sound assembly may stay below a full replacement price.
What an estimate should include
A useful estimate should define the measured railing length and identify which posts, rails, balusters, or connections will be repaired or replaced. It should also state whether labor, materials, removal, disposal, finish work, and permit fees are included.
The price may change after removal exposes concealed rot or an inadequate attachment. Work beyond the railing—such as repairing rim boards, joists, stairs, or other supports—should be separated from the railing price so the expanded scope is clear.
Compare the scope, not just the total
Ask each estimator to use the same railing length, repair-versus-replacement assumption, material, finish, permit allowance, and supporting-deck scope. Otherwise, two totals may describe different jobs.
The main cost drivers
The biggest variables are practical rather than cosmetic:
- Repair depth: tightening accessible hardware costs less than rebuilding posts or replacing complete sections.
- Length and layout: stairs, gates, corners, and many post locations add fitting and labor time.
- Material and finish: wood, metal, composite, cable, and glass have different material and installation costs.
- Access: elevated decks, tight yards, and difficult debris removal can increase labor.
- Supporting condition: rot, corrosion, or failed framing connections can turn a railing job into a structural repair.
- Location and approvals: regional labor rates vary, and permit rules and fees are local.
Permit treatment is especially property-specific. For example, Issaquah, Washington, classifies removing, altering, or repairing a railing or guard as a deck modification. That local example should not be treated as a nationwide rule; the applicable building department must confirm the requirement for the property.
When to obtain a specialist estimate
Obtain an on-site evaluation when the railing moves under normal contact, posts are split or decayed, fasteners pull from deteriorated wood, or damage continues into the deck frame. A qualified deck contractor can price a defined repair. A structural engineer or other licensed design professional may be needed when the supporting framing, unusual connections, or local permit authority requires design work.
Treat a moving or incomplete guard as a fall hazard
Keep people off the deck and block access when a guard is loose, missing, or visibly deteriorated. Do not rely on the railing for support. Arrange a qualified evaluation, confirm permit requirements with the local building authority, and restore the guard before the deck returns to use.
